Hannibal was famously an enemy of Rome, with the Roman Republic gaining power throughout his life and having defeated Carthage during the First Punic War. Hannibal quickly became a force to be reckoned with during the Second Punic War, with him taking part in some major battles. Even after his days as a general were over, Hannibal continued working against Rome. After running for the office of sufet, Hannibal enacted policies that were unpopular in Rome, with him later advising Antiochus III the Great during his war against Rome.

Since Hannibal’s life is so storied, there are all kinds of narratives thatAntoine Fuqua’s Hannibal moviecould follow. However,Deadlinehas reported that the film will be set during the Second Punic War, following Hannibal as he leads his armies in some pivotal battles against Rome. Since Hannibal will most likely be the protagonist of the film, this means that Denzel Washington’s Hannibal will be framed as a hero who fought against Rome, which is incredibly interesting considering hisGladiator IIstory.
While Denzel Washington’s Macrinus does make some moves that attempt to overthrow the Roman Empire inGladiator II, the character overall loves Rome, with him only hoping that he can be the one in charge. In the latter parts ofGladiator II, Macrinus is leading Rome in battles for the empire,which is ironic considering Washington’s Hannibal movie role. After playing a character who only fights for Rome, Washington will now be playing a character who only fights against it, with him giving both sides of the ancient story.
